A die is rolled 2 times. What is the probability of getting a 2 on the first roll and a 5 on the second roll?

Answer:

1/36

Explanation:

the chance of rolling a 2 on a 6-sided die is 1/6 and rolling a 5 on a 6-sided is also 1/6.

So, 1/6 * 1/6 = 1/36
